A Momo Fan? You Need To Try These Momo Varieties!
The word itself it’s so cute and sounds delicious, you’re bound to fall in love with it! That’s how we all feel about this Northeast Asian version of a dumpling. So it’s time you forget the plain, bland Dal Chawal and Achar because momo, our favourite go-to snack is slowly becoming a staple food in most North Eastern as well as Northern food culture, and why not?
Originating from Nepal and Tibet, it’s kept its authenticity intact, though certain cities with its booming popularity have added their unique twists to make it work locally. Now found in every cafe you see such locations; it has become a favourite rather a staple choice for most at it is both delicious and cheap! They’re that tasty that people now make their own after looking for recipes of vegetable and chicken momos online. A first the traditional delicacy was initially sculpted in a rounder shape with either meat or vegetable stuffing in the middle, but now you’re bound to find numerous varieties of momo in different shapes, sizes and stuffing as well. Remember the different shapes and sizes and stuffing we spoke about? Well, here are a few that you need to try, before picking your favourite. Ps - there’s no point in picking a favourite, each momo is equally delicious!
Steamed Momos
This list had to start off with the classic, the one variety that started it all - steamed momos! This preparation style has been around for the longest and is undoubtedly everyone’s go-to when it comes to picking a favourite, rightfully so. As if the recipe is so old but still going strong, it has to be perfect. These scrumptious and juicy momos are made by filling them with well-seasoned and cooked veggies or minced meat and are wrapped together to be placed in a dumpling steamer. They’re turn out incredibly soft and just tend to dissolve in your mouths. You can never go wrong with this one, as one may find them ready-made as well, through frozen momos online.
Fried Momos
A relatively new concept, but this is for those who are looking for a loud crunch in each bite. And the best way to get that crunch is through the fried version of momos, made by deep-frying the momo in boiling oil. They might turn out a bit oily, but the taste will totally make you forget about your health-conscious thoughts, that is our guarantee.
Half and half Momos
If you are reading this, you’re probably looking for the best of both worlds. You want your momos to have that soft melting texture, but also want a little bit of the crunch - so half and half momos are perfect for those very reasons. Commonly known as kothey momos, they’re made by frying up already steamed momos in an elongated shape.
Chilly Momos
People who have a tolerance for spicy food, this one’s solely for you. Chilly momos are quite popular in the Northeast, among those who want that special kick in their taste buds. The momos are mostly steamed momos, but they arrive at your tables drenched in a spicy and tangy sauce.
Soupy Momos
Momo soups have become quite mainstream as well, with it being a delicious alternative to both regular soups and regular momos. Primarily made with chicken broth, the momos come submerged in the hot steaming soup, blending well with the flavours while giving it a nice balance. For a freezing cold day, this one should be your go-to. And luckily for us, you’ll find several frozen momos supplies near me and you to make the perfect momo soup.
Tandoori Momo
The lip-smacking combo of momo and tandoori has become quite the trend at the moment, and definitely a one to watch out for. Using one of the most popular methods to prepare your favourite dish, this combo has ‘scrumptious’ written all over it! The tandoor style adds a whole new dimension to the dish making it the most sought after, right after our classic steamed momos.
Green Momos
We all hated spinach as a kid, right? Well, not anymore! Green momos are a delicious way to add the goodness of spinach to your balls of flavour as the dough is made of spinach blended with flour and kneaded with the water from the spinach. And so the name and the colour of their derived from spinach.
